The crack vs cocaine sentencing disparity has disproportionately affected Black and Hispanic individuals, leading to racial disparities in the criminal justice system. This has resulted in longer sentences for crack cocaine offenses compared to powder cocaine offenses, contributing to mass incarceration and perpetuating systemic inequalities.
The key points of contention in the ongoing libertarian vs liberal debate revolve around the role of government in society. Libertarians advocate for minimal government intervention in both economic and social matters, prioritizing individual freedom and limited government power. Liberals, on the other hand, believe in a more active government role in addressing social and economic inequalities, promoting social welfare programs, and regulating certain industries. The debate often centers on issues such as taxation, healthcare, education, and civil liberties.

Patriots were those who supported the independence of the American colonies from the British Empire. Loyalists were loyal to the British crown. Roughly speaking, Patriots and Loyalists were each a third of the population, with the remaining third not taking a side. Conflicts between Patriots and Loyalists weren't just fought on the battlefield. Especially in the backcountry, old feuds were often continued between supporters of both sides. As is the case in any civil war, these conflicts were often brutal, with murders, arson, and other crimes perpetrated by both sides.

The Siege of Fort Vincennes occurred during the American Revolutionary War. It was a battle fought by Great Britain and Native Americans vs the Patriot militia, in February of 1779. The Patriot militia was victorious.
